Formatted Contents Note: | Section 1. The nature of multiculturalism in children -- Mexican-American culture / Olivia N. Saracho and Frances Martinez Hancock -- Black children : their roots, culture, and learning styles / Janice Hale -- Coyote in the classroom : the use of American-Indian oral tradition with young children / Terry Tafoya -- Early education for Asian-American children / Margie K. Kitano -- Early childhood bilingualism : some considerations from second-language acquisition research / Rosario C. Gingras -- Section 2. Educational practices and materials -- Classroom methods and materials / Jeanne B. Morris -- Counteracting racism and sexism in children's books / Bradford Chambers -- Parent and community involvement / Theresa Herrera Escobedo -- Section 3. Issues in preparing early childhood educators -- Preparing teachers for bilingual/multicultural classrooms / Olivia N. Saracho and Bernard Spodek -- Education and human services delivery / Dean C. Corrigan. |
